First off, we need to know the location of these stripes. Are they two arched over three "V's" ? Those would be a chief (enlisted rating). If they are long stripes running diagonal on the sleeve, they represent time in service...ie, each one indicates 4 years of service. Hope this helps.

What army rank is tech 5?

Tech 5 was a special rank above a Corporal(2 stripes on the sleeve). The Tec 5 insignia was 2 stripes with a "T" under the stripe. Tech 4 was 3 stripes and a "T". The "T" indicates the Technical rank which meant the soldier's promotion was based on his training and the rank did not carry any leadership responsibilities. This rank was discontinued after WW2 and the "Specialists" rank was introduced.


Is Commander a rank in the army?

No, there is no rank of commander in the Army. In the Army commander is a title, not a rank. In the Navy, there is a rank of Commander, it is the equivalent of Lt Colonel or O-5.
